Abstract

Examples of recoater carriages in an additive manufacturing system are described. In one case, a recoater carriage assembly has an elongate powder build material spreader, such as a roller, to spread powder build material in use. The recoater carriage assembly has a recoater carriage to support the spreader. The spreader is to engage and to disengage from the recoater carriage by movement of the spreader non-concentrically to a longitudinal axis of the spreader.

Claims (33)

1. A recoater carriage assembly for use in an additive manufacturing system, the recoater carriage assembly comprising:

an elongate powder build material spreader to spread powder build material in use;

a recoater carriage to support the spreader; and

a lid to at least partially cover the spreader when the spreader is engaged with the recoater carriage;

wherein the spreader is to engage with, and to disengage from, the recoater carriage by movement of the spreader non-concentrically to a longitudinal axis of the spreader;

wherein the lid is to retain the spreader relative to the recoater carriage when the spreader is engaged with the recoater carriage.

2. The recoater carriage assembly of claim 1 , comprising a retainer to retain the spreader in engagement with the recoater carriage.

3. The recoater carriage assembly of claim 2 , wherein the retainer comprises a resilient element to bias the spreader into engagement with the recoater carriage.

4. The recoater carriage assembly of claim 1 , wherein

the spreader comprises at least one projection,

the recoater carriage comprises at least one recess, and

the at least one projection of the spreader projects into the at least one recess of the carriage when the spreader is engaged with the carriage.

5. The recoater carriage assembly of claim 1 , wherein

the spreader comprises a drive element,

the carriage comprises a drive mechanism, and

the movement of the spreader is to engage the drive element of the spreader with the drive mechanism of the carriage.

6. The recoater carriage assembly of claim 1 , wherein the spreader is a roller.

7. A carriage to carry a recoater roller for use in an additive manufacturing system, the carriage comprising:

a first support and a second support, wherein the first support is spaced in a first direction from the second support, and

a lid to at least partially cover a recoater roller when the recoater roller is engaged with the first support and the second support,

wherein the first support and the second support are to engage with the recoater roller by movement of the recoater roller in a second direction that is different from the first direction,

wherein the lid comprises a retainer to retain the recoater roller relative to at least one of the first support and second support when the recoater roller is engaged with the first support and the second support.

8. The carriage of claim 7 , wherein the first direction is orthogonal to the second direction.

9. The carriage of claim 7 , wherein the first support and the second support are immovable relative to each other.

10. The carriage of claim 7 , wherein at least one of the first support and the second support comprises a channel or slot in the carriage.

11. The carriage of claim 7 , wherein the retainer is resilient to bias the recoater roller towards the first support and second support when the recoater roller is engaged with the first support and the second support.

12. The carriage of claim 7 , wherein the carriage comprises a gear to engage with a gear of the recoater roller when the recoater roller is engaged with the first support and the second support.

13. A method of using a recoater carriage assembly in an additive manufacturing system, the method comprising:

removing a lid that at least partially covers an elongate recoater roller and that retains the elongate recoater roller relative to a recoater carriage when the elongate recoater roller is engaged with the recoater carriage; and

moving the elongate recoater roller in a direction non-concentric to a longitudinal axis of the elongate recoater roller and relative to the recoater carriage to disengage the elongate recoater roller from the recoater carriage.

14. The method of claim 13 , wherein the roller is a first roller;

wherein the method comprises, after the moving, engaging with the recoater carriage a second elongate recoater roller; and

wherein a surface characteristic of the first and second rollers differs between the first and second rollers.
